Responsibilities
- Develop and manage the quality management system to ensure compliance with processes, work instructions, certifications, and regulatory requirements.
- Investigate anomalies in manufacturing, supply chain, testing, and flight, identifying and mitigating the immediate and underlying root causes to manage risk and improve the reliability of designs and processes.
- Support the development, manufacturing, and verification of products using continuous improvement and statistical techniques.
- Develop, implement, and validate test and inspection methodologies for new and existing products, ensuring objective criteria are consistently met and quality goals are met.
- Derive, automate, and report quality metrics to the business and provide recommendations for design, product, and process improvements.
- Basic Success Criteria
- Bachelor's Degree in Mechanical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Aerospace, Software Engineering, or a similar advanced degree
- 7+ years of professional experience in design engineering, manufacturing, test, software, or quality and reliability engineering
- 2+ years of professional experience with investigations, design of experiments, and other investigatory and problem-solving methods
- Experience with quality, risk, and/or safety management systems and processes
- Preferred Criteria
- 2+ years of experience with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) regulatory requirements (e.g., 14 CFR 21, DO-160, D0-254, etc.)
- 2+ years of programming experience in Python, C, or SQL with an emphasis on data analysis and automation
- Experience evaluating, defining, strategizing, and executing test campaigns and procedures
- Experience developing engineering infrastructure and tools in support of the Quality Management System (QMS)
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ills

We're building safety-enhancing technology for aviation that will save lives. Automated aviation systems will enable a future where air transportation is safer, more convenient and fundamentally transformative to the way goods - and eventually people - move around the planet. We are a team of mission-driven engineers with experience across aerospace, robotics and self-driving cars working to make this future a reality. As a Sr. Quality Assurance and Reliability Engineer, you'll be a part of the Production organization. You'll bring the technical leadership required to verify product safety and reliability, lead investigations, identify and implement corrective actions, and ensure improvements are implemented. This is a small but growing team of highly motivated people who are passionate about delivering quality products and services with velocity and unquestionable value. You will be responsible for the strategy and execution of the quality management system, risk mitigation, risk prevention, design reliability, hardware reliability, flight reliability, test validation, and production optimization.
